Transaction 21fc88974ae1a6114986072d76ef9172a35c7c4e59fe654d9a4bd328e89a0516

5 Input
2 Outputs
  • 21fc88974ae1a6114986072d76ef9172a35c7c4e59fe654d9a4bd328e89a0516:0
  • value  1400000
    address  3KCZvc8bRevPVbHkcNQ6odxx7cGsVCZBRA
  • 21fc88974ae1a6114986072d76ef9172a35c7c4e59fe654d9a4bd328e89a0516:1
  • value  34019
    address  35mHXpDCGTeDEgSMwbhsERRzapD8zmeWCo